安装R包
安装R包
要使用我们的R接口,您需要在本地的R安装中安装Gurobi包。这样做的R命令是:
安装。包(' < R-package-file >”,回购= NULL)Gurobi R包文件可以在
< installdir > / R
Gurobi安装的默认目录< installdir >
对于Gurobi 8.0.0是/ opt / gurobi800 / linux64对于Linux,c: \ gurobi800 \ win64适用于64位Windows/图书馆/ gurobi800 / mac64Mac)。你应该浏览< installdir > / R
目录下查找平台文件的确切名称(Linux包位于“file . conf”文件中gurobi_
8.0 0
_R_x86_64-pc-linux-gnu.tar.gz
, Windows包在文件中gurobi_
8.0 - -0.邮政, Mac包在文件中gurobi_
8.0 - -0. tgz).您需要小心确保所安装的R二进制文件和Gurobi包都使用相同的指令集。例如,如果您正在使用64位版本的R,那么您将需要安装64位版本的Gurobi,以及64位的Gurobi R包。这在Windows系统上尤为重要,因为在Windows系统中,指令集不匹配导致的错误消息可能非常神秘。
要运行Gurobi发行版提供的R示例之一,您可以使用源
例如,如果你在Gurobi R examples目录中运行R,你可以这样说:
>源(“mip.R”)
如果Gurobi包安装成功,您应该看到以下输出:
[1] '解决方案:' [1]3 [1]1 0 1